A train trip from Dorchester South to Brentwood takes about 4hrs 33 mins on average, covering roughly 134 miles (215 kilometres). With around 33 trains running each day, there's plenty of flexibility for your travel plans. If you book in advance, you can grab tickets starting from just £18.60, making it a budget-friendly option for those who plan ahead.

Nestled in the charming county of Dorset, Dorchester South train station serves as a vital gateway for travelers to explore the picturesque landscapes and historic attractions of Southern England. This station provides numerous facilities to ensure a comfortable and efficient journey for all passengers.
Dorchester South station is equipped with a ticket office, which is open daily with varied hours from early morning till early evening. For those who enjoy the convenience of buying their tickets online, ticket machines are available for collecting online purchases. Notably, these machines are accessible for disabled persons and allow for Disabled Persons Railcard discounts. However, no staff help is available at the station, and it is essential to be aware that while an induction loop is present, the station may pose accessibility challenges due to limited step-free access across platforms.
For your convenience, lounges and waiting rooms are heated and available during the station’s operating hours. Although there are no refreshment facilities within, the station offers public Wi-Fi. Despite the absence of on-site ATMs or shopping options, this connectivity ensures you can plan your journey or catch up on work as you wait for your train. While there’s no cycle hire, bike storage is available with lockers and racks for secure parking.
The station forecourt, located off Weymouth Avenue, is the designated point for rail replacement services, offering a seamless option for continued travel. Although there is no dedicated taxi rank, local bus services provide connections, and more information is available on planning onward journeys. The presence of only two accessible parking spaces may require prior planning for those traveling by car.

Brentwood Station is well-equipped with a range of facilities to ensure a comfortable and convenient travel experience. The ticket office is a hub of activity, open from 06:10 to 20:00 on weekdays and Saturdays, and slightly adjusted to 07:10 to 20:10 on Sundays. For travelers on the go, ticket machines are readily available along with an option to pick up tickets ordered online. Accessibility is a priority here, with accessible ticket machines located within both the ticket hall on Warley Hill and inside the entrance on platform 4, The Parade. Step-free access is part and parcel of the station's layout, with staff ramp assistance available.
While waiting rooms might not grace the platforms, covered seating areas are available, providing comfort while awaiting your ride. Refreshments and essentials can be picked up at the coffee shop on Platform 3 or from the newsagent strategically positioned at the top of the staircase to Platform 1. Staying connected is hassle-free with public Wi-Fi access across the station.
Connections don't merely begin and end with train tracks at Brentwood. For instances where the railway takes a pause, rail replacement services are on hand from Alexandra Road. Should you wish to zip across the town post-train, a conveniently placed taxi office lights your path at the platform 4 entrance on The Parade. Local bus services are within arm’s reach, plying the routes stationed right outside – making navigation and travel planning simple and straightforward, aided by handy printables found here.
The Elizabeth Line extends a direct connection to Heathrow Airport, facilitating effortless transitions for international travelers or city-hoppers. For those with a preference for self-navigation, the station also caters to cyclists, offering bicycle storage (some sheltered) with CCTV coverage.
